Illustration
Choir tryouts were a nerve-racking experience for the students. The day the choir was
announced, Sandra sat with fingers crossed and legs that bounced to some unheard beat.
Mr. Jackman, the director, came into the room and began to read the names to his new
choir. Sandra's heart fell; her name had not been read. At the end of his recitation, Mr.
Jackman read four more names. These four were set aside for special duty and training.
They would be the four section leaders and as such would meet with Mr. Jackman each
morning for one hour in preparation for the choir practice after school.
